SPARTANBURG, S.C. (WSPA) — Hundreds packed a public hearing Thursday to voice opposition to a proposed air permit for NorthMark Strategies’ data center under construction on South Pine Street.
The South Carolina Department of Environmental Services held the hearing to hear public comments and concerns, as the agency is reviewing the company’s permit application.
In April 2025, NorthMark Strategies announced a $2.8 billion operation to convert the former Kohler manufacturing plant into a high-performance computing center.
